Tensile Testing of Paper

ASTM D828, TAPPI T 220, TAPPI T 456, and TAPPI T 494 are testing standards used to measure the properties of paper and paperboard products. TAPPI T 494 and ASTM D828 are the most commonly used paper testing standards and measure tensile strength of dry paper products. TAPPI T 456 is used to test the tensile strength of water saturated paper (wet tensile strength), and TAPPI T 220 is used to test pulp sheets.

Manufacturers of paper goods need to evaluate the physical properties of their products to ensure they are able to function as intended. Small variations in fibers, fiber treatments, or manufacturing processes can impact the tensile strength of paper products. Certain papers are required to conform to a desired contour, such as paper towels or napkins, and require a certain tensile stiffness. Printing paper, which is usually produced in large sheets or rolls, must withstand forces experienced during its travel through processing equipment. Aside from paper manufacturers, the packaging industry also uses paper testing standards to ensure that bags, boxes, and other packaging materials do not fail during transport or shipment.
